Output 3c8d17e34b2db22bca1ed202f26be5ecb75d83f25217ef911bba17192b787214:0

value
3104095
script pubkey
OP_0 OP_PUSHBYTES_20 512efe6b2fa368f631c6b4a2f067001b14b1f58a
address
bc1q2yh0u6e05d50vvwxkj30qecqrv2trav2jeup9y
transaction
3c8d17e34b2db22bca1ed202f26be5ecb75d83f25217ef911bba17192b787214
spent
true